Please contact Meghan Allen in HR @ View phone number on click.appcast.io General Summary Under the direct supervision of the Regional Credit Manager, the Credit Associate supports the credit/collection effort within an assigned geographic territory in order to cultivate good business relationships while adhering to firm guidelines regarding payment practices. Essential Functions Review accounts and determine the direction to take to collect outstanding passed due balances. Make collections calls and determine, within prescribed guidelines, payment plans consistent with maintaining a continuing sales relationship. Research and resolve account problems. Determine the facts, analyze them and follow up until the project is completed. Provide support for new application processing and file updates, by conducting a credit investigation and making a recommendation for approval with the respective credit manager. Final approval is done by respective credit manager. Physical attendance at work is an essential function of the Credit Associate position. Job requires frequent interactions and face to face with co‑workers. Provide additional support. Maintain knowledge and understanding of current laws, regulations, and legal issues as they pertain to credit, collection activities and other job duties. Performs other related duties as assigned. Knowledge, Skills and Abilities Good communication and organization skills. A professional telephone manner. Ability to multi-task in a fast-paced work environment. PC skills; including Word, Excel and Internet. Preferred Education and Qualifications High School diploma or equivalent. Three years of credit/collection, accounts receivable or related experience. Work Environment Office with cubicles equipped with computer terminal. Sit at desk and work with computer keyboard/mouse, and phone 95% of the day. Moderate to heavy lifting when covering mailroom.
